One pot creamy tomato beef pasta

One pot creamy tomato beef pasta

This One pot creamy tomato beef pasta is a delicious and easy meal made in one pot.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Course Main Course
Cuisine Italian
Servings 5 servings
Calories 610 kcal

Equipment

  • large heavy-based pot

Ingredients
  

  • 1.5 tablespoon ol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ic finely minced
  • 1 onion finely chopped
  • 500 g beef mince / ground beef
  • 2 teaspoon Italian herbs (Note 1)
  • 2 tablespoon tomato paste
  • 400 g crushed tomatoes (or tomato passata)
  • 0.5 teaspoon red pepper flakes (chilli flakes, optional)
  • 1.5 teaspoon cooking salt /kosher sal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 4 cups chicken stock /broth, low sodium (Note 2)
  • 350 g fusilli /penne, elbow macaroni or other short pasta (Note 3)
  • 0.75 cups thickened cream

Serving

  • Parmesan cheese finely grated
  • Parsley finely chopped, optional

Instructions
 

  • Heat the oil on high heat in a large heavy-based pot. Cook garlic and onion for 1 ½ minutes.
  • Add beef and cook, breaking it up as you go, until you can no longer see red meat. Add the Italian herbs and cook for 30 seconds, then add tomato paste and cook for 1 minute to cook out the raw flavour.
  • Add crushed tomato, chicken stock, salt, pepper and red pepper flakes, if using. Stir, then add the pasta.
  • Bring the liquid to a simmer, then cook for 15 minutes, stirring every couple of minutes then more frequently towards the end (ensure pasta doesn't stick to base) until the pasta is just about cooked.
  • Add cream, then simmer for a further 1 to 2 minutes. It will still be quite saucy – this is what you want! Pasta absorbs liquid quickly, so it will still be nice and oozy when you start eating.
  • Remove from the stove. Give it a good stir then ladle into bowls. Serve with parmesan and parsley.

Notes

Italian Herbs – Just a store bought mix, very common at grocery stores. If you don’t have any, just use a mix of dried oregano, parsley, basil. Or sub with a teaspoon of Worcestershire sauce. Chicken stock/broth – Tastier than water! I stock up when on sale. Economical alternative – I recommend using Vegeta stock powder or Chinese chicken stock powder plus water. Any short pasta will work here, like macaroni, penne etc but not tiny ones like risoni/orzo. If using long pasta, easiest to break in half and you can cook about 400g/14oz. Leftovers will keep for 3 days in the fridge. Not suitable for freezing.
